Imagine: a cascade of soft white to pale yellow flowers transforming your garden into a romantic scene. That is the enchanting Banksiae White, a historic climbing rose admired since the 18th century for its unparalleled charm. With its masses of small, semi-double flowers and a subtle, mildly sweet fragrance, this nearly thornless beauty brings timeless elegance and a touch of history to any outdoor space.
The Banksiae White is a vigorous grower and can easily reach heights of 6 to 10 meters, making it perfect for lushly covering pergolas, walls, or fences. It also thrives as a tree climber, where its exuberant spring bloom creates a spectacular accent. It grows best in a sunny spot but also tolerates light shade, even on a north-facing wall. Moreover, it is a true magnet for bees and butterflies, filling your garden with life and movement.

Roses in pots
A potted rose is a rose plant that has already been grown in a pot and is delivered with a well-developed root system. These roses are ready to be planted directly in the garden or in a larger pot, without having to wait for root growth. This makes the potted rose ideal for planting throughout the year, especially from May through October.
Roses with bare roots
Bare-root roses – also called root roses – are rose plants delivered without a pot or soil. These roses are dormant and can be planted directly in open ground. The best time to plant a root rose is in autumn or early spring, when the soil is still moist and the temperature mild.
